## Service Accounts — StormFan Alert Fan-Out

The fan-out worker authenticates to the internal dispatch tier using the svc-stormfan account. Rotate quarterly; scopes are limited to publish-only on alert topics. If deliveries stall during your shift, verify the worker is using the current credential, reproduced below for reference.

API key for kaweg-hahif: kto4_rAjZ

**Ticket: Signature check failing on FieldNote offline bundles**

New folks: FieldNote's offline mode ships survey forms as signed bundles so field devices trust them without connectivity. Last night's build failed verification on all Tarnwick test tablets — the bundle was signed with a rotated key the devices no longer trust. Rebuild and re-sign with the current release key. For reference, the correct signing key is below.

rollout seal: bky4_x7Gc

## Further Reading

Pickwright's routing heuristics are documented elsewhere; this README covers only the plugin interface. Before writing a custom cost function, read the slotting model spec and the aisle-graph notes. Plugins that ignore congestion weights will be rejected by the validator. Benchmarks against the Harlowe warehouse dataset are refreshed weekly. For the full optimizer architecture, scoring internals, and plugin submission checklist, see the internal page below.

operations page: https://jenkins.zemvarcloud.local/job/merge_requests/repo/build/73930b4b30f0a8ed

// Broker upgrade notes for plugin authors:
// Quillbus 4.x replaces the legacy 3.x wire protocol. Plugins must
// construct the client with explicit protocol negotiation enabled,
// or connections to the Larkfield cluster will be silently downgraded
// and dropped after 30s. Topic names are unchanged. For local testing
// against the sandbox broker, authenticate with the key below.

API key for bafof-bagaf: qvz2-qi